Immunomodulatory potential of Eucheuma serra as haemocyte cell production enhancer on Litopenaeus vannamei. pp. 1393-1400. ISSN 1511-3701
Abstract
Litopenaeus vannamei is one of the most well-known fishery products and has high market value. In contrast production of vannamei shrimp is facing threats from several diseases caused by bacteria virus and even parasites that attack the shrimp immune system. The purpose of this study is to identify the immunomodulatory effect of Eucheuma serra extract to enhance haemocyte cells production in Litopenaeus vannamei as the non-specific internal immune substance. The research method used was a complete randomised design with 5 concentrations of injected Eucheuma serra extract treatments and one placebo as control. Eucheuma serra extract administered on shrimp abdomen and the haemocyte cell samples collected from shrimp on day 0 and day 6. Treatment using 8 ppm injected Eucheuma serra extract showed the highest haemocyte cell amount increase about 15.90 million cells/ml in 6 days after injection. Statistical calculation using ANOVA test showed a significant difference in the amount of haemocyte cell at before and after treatment.
